Of course,the wallets werent hacked,only the DNS which the official mew website are using but it is already fixed,and those people who transact that time are the only ones who got hacked,because they were redirected to a phishing site where these hackers managed to get those keys easily as these users doesnt know that the DNS servers were hacked.

Why wouldnt we use mew? because theres some hack few days ago? not really hacked because the wallets on their platform is safe,the attackers use the DNs servers which myetherwallet.com are using which is these hackers has managed to redirect the users to a fake mew website ,that is why those people who are using mew got hacked.
